Skip to main content

HTML-Entitäten-Decodierer Decodieren Sie HTML-Entitäten zurück in ihre ursprünglichen Zeichen.

HTML-Entitäten-Decodierer illustration
📝

HTML-Entitäten-Decodierer

Decodieren Sie HTML-Entitäten zurück in ihre ursprünglichen Zeichen.

1

Kodierten Text einfügen

Fügen Sie Text mit HTML-Entitäten ein.

2

Automatische Dekodierung

HTML-Entitäten werden in Zeichen zurückkonvertiert.

3

Ergebnis kopieren

Kopieren Sie den dekodierten Text.

Loading tool...

What Is HTML-Entitäten-Decodierer?

Der HTML-Entity-Decoder konvertiert HTML-Entitäten zurück in ihre ursprünglichen Zeichen. Er unterstützt benannte Entitäten wie &amp; (→ &), &lt; (→ <), &gt; (→ >) und viele weitere, sowie dezimale numerische Entitäten (&#38;) und hexadezimale numerische Entitäten (&#x26;). Dies ist nützlich, wenn Sie mit HTML-Quellcode arbeiten, Webinhalte scannen oder kodierten Text in eine lesbare Form umwandeln. Der Decoder unterstützt alle gängigen benannten Entitäten sowie jede dezimale oder hexadezimale numerische Entität.

Why Use HTML-Entitäten-Decodierer?

  • Konvertieren von geskrabtem HTML-Inhalt in lesbaren Text
  • Dekodieren von Entitäten, die im HTML-Quellcode gefunden werden
  • Wiederherstellen der ursprünglichen Zeichen aus kodiertem Inhalt
  • Verarbeiten von HTML-Daten für nicht-HTML-Kontexte

Common Use Cases

Web Scraping

Dekodieren von HTML-Entitäten in geskrabtem Inhalt, um lesbaren Text zu erhalten.

Datenverarbeitung

Konvertieren von HTML-kodierten Daten zurück in Klartext für die Analyse.

Inhaltsmigration

Dekodieren von Entitäten beim Übertragen von Inhalten von HTML zu anderen Formaten.

Fehlerbehebung

Überprüfen, welche Zeichen durch HTML-Entitäten dargestellt werden.

Technical Guide

Der Decoder funktioniert in drei Phasen. Zuerst ersetzt er gängige benannte Entitäten mithilfe einer Lookup-Tabelle, die &amp;, &lt;, &gt;, &quot;, &nbsp; und Symbol-Entitäten wie &copy;, &trade;, &euro; usw. abdeckt. Zweitens verarbeitet er dezimale numerische Entitäten (&#NNN;) mit String.fromCharCode(parseInt(code, 10)), um den Dezimalzeichencode in sein Zeichen umzuwandeln. Drittens verarbeitet er hexadezimale numerische Entitäten (&#xHHH;) ähnlich mit parseInt(code, 16). Dies deckt die gesamte Bandbreite der HTML-Entity-Codierungsmethoden ab. Benannte Entitäten werden zuerst verarbeitet, damit teilweise decodierter Text in der numerischen Entity-Phase keine falschen Übereinstimmungen erzeugt.

Tips & Best Practices

  • 1
    Unterstützt sowohl benannte (&amp;) als auch numerische (&#38;) Entitätsformate
  • 2
    Nützlich für die Bereinigung von HTML-Quellcode vor der Textverarbeitung
  • 3
    Unterstützt Währungs-, Urheberrechts- und Sonderzeichenentitäten
  • 4
    Kombinieren mit dem Entfernen von HTML-Tags für die vollständige Textextraktion

Related Tools

Frequently Asked Questions

Q Welche Arten von Entitäten kann es dekodieren?
Benannte Entitäten (wie &amp;), dezimale numerische (wie &#38;) und hexadezimale numerische (wie &#x26;).
Q Unterstützt es alle benannten Entitäten?
Es deckt die meisten gängigen benannten Entitäten ab. Weniger gebräuchliche müssen möglicherweise im numerischen Format vorliegen.
Q Entfernt es auch HTML-Tags?
Nein, es dekodiert nur Entitäten. Verwenden Sie das Tool HTML zu Markdown, um Tags zu entfernen und in Text umzuwandeln.
Q Was ist &nbsp;?
&nbsp; ist ein ununterbrochener Leerraum. Der Dekodierer wandelt ihn in ein normales Leerzeichen um.
Q Kann es doppelkodierte Entitäten verarbeiten?
Es unterstützt einfache Kodierung. Für doppelkodierte Texte (wie &amp;amp;) muss der Dekodierer zweimal ausgeführt werden.

About This Tool

HTML-Entitäten-Decodierer is a free online tool by FreeToolkit.ai. All processing happens directly in your browser — your data never leaves your device. No registration or installation required.